Aldi has just launched a new, free Easter Planner App which aims to offer you food and cooking suggestions while also including some novel features.
The App includes kids’ activities such as planning your own Easter egg hunt and making Easter bonnets. There is a good selection of recipes available within the App while it also comes with an in-built meal planner and Easter food prep tips and drinks ideas.
The App allows you to receive push notifications which will inform you of Aldi’s Special Buys every Thursday and Sunday in the run up to Easter.
The App is available in the Google Play Store and the iOS App Store now.
